Early signs from the U.S. Futures Index suggest that WallStreet might open in negative ... the S&P 500 futures were declining 12.50 points and the Nasdaq 100 futures were sliding 57.25 points.
The mean price target of $38.04 represents a premium of only 5.8% to NI's current levels. The Street-high price target of $40, implies a potential upside of 11.3% from the current price levels.
However, FSLR has outpaced the First Trust NASDAQ Clean Edge Green Energy Index ... sell-off of renewable energy-focused stocks on WallStreet. For the current fiscal, ending in December, ...
Some results have been hidden because they may be inaccessible to you